AIR CASUALTIES
LATEST OFFICIAL LIST. (Bv Telegraph—Press Association.) WELLINGTON, This Day. The following air casualties were announced today: CANNON. Sergeant Edward Dennis, R.N.Z.A.F., killed in action. Wife, Mrs L. Z. Cannon, Stratford. HOARE, Sergeant Brian Patrick, R.N.Z.A.F.. missing on air operations. Father, Mr J. P. Hoare, Palmerston North. JONES. Pilot Officer Stanley Charles, R.N.Z.A.F., killed in air accident. Mother, Mrs R. Coakley, Lower Hutt. STEWART, Sergeant Alexander, R.A.F., prisoner of war. Brother, Mr M. R. Stewart, Fordell. ATKINSON, Sergeant Lionel Edmund. R.N.Z.A.F., previously reported missing now reported prisoner of war. Wife, Mrs L. E. Atkinson, Wellington. BAIRD. Acting Flight Lieutenant Angus Bruce, R.N.Z.A.F., previously reported missing, death now officially, presumed. Father, Dr. J. H. Baird, Wyndham. GOLDFINCH, Sergeant Gavin Mathew, R.N.Z.A.F., previously reported missing, now reported prisoner of war. Father, Mr P. J. Goldfinch. Auckland. WHITING, Pilot Officer Jack Gaius, R.N.Z.A.F., previously reported missing, now reported prisoner of war. Father, Mr W. Whiting, Auckland.
